- “Be Still Journal” – The Daily Grace Co. $28.00
  
This journal is perfect for Scripture reading. It’s very organized and separated into four parts: Be Still, Abide, Adore and Apply. It helps you pick apart the verses you read and really allows you to dig deep into God’s Word. My favorite journal!

2. She Reads Truth Bible – Christian Book – $26.99 (on sale now)

This Bible is awesome! I wanted a journaling Bible and kept checking this one out on Instagram. It’s not only beautiful (it comes in different covers/materials), but has really great added features. It has space for journaling, timelines, a beautiful key verse for each book, devotionals throughout, book summaries, maps and each book is colored coded according to its theme. This Bible has really helped grow my love for God’s Word even more.

4. Pens/Highlighters – The Daily Grace Co. (prices vary)

These highlighters are the best I’ve ever used for Bible highlighting. I love to highlight in my Bible, but I hate when it bleeds through the pages. These highlighters from Daily Grace Co. are wax, not ink, so they don’t smear or bleed through. They come in a variety pack of six different colors, with an inspirational word on each one. 9. Bracelets – Mudlove/Belove (prices vary)

MudLove bracelets have been around for awhile now and make really great gifts. They come with a variety of inspirational words and the bands come in an assortment of colors. You can also custom-make one on their website with whatever word(s) and band color you want. The coolest thing about these bracelets is that all purchases go towards clean water in Africa (through Water for Good). They make really meaningful gifts for others.
